Transport your taste buds to the sun-soaked shores of Sicily with this vibrant Sicilian Spaghetti recipe, an authentic celebration of bold Mediterranean flavors. Featuring tender al dente spaghetti tossed in a rich, savory sauce made with extra virgin olive oil, garlic, anchovy fillets, and cherry tomatoes, this dish is a perfect marriage of simplicity and sophistication. Black olives, capers, and a hint of red chili flakes add a delightful depth and a subtle kick, while fresh parsley and Parmesan cheese crown the dish with a touch of freshness and creaminess. Ready in just 30 minutes, this quick and satisfying recipe is ideal for weeknight dinners or entertaining guests. 🥘 Ingredients

12 items
  • 400 grams spaghetti
  • 4 tablespoons extra virgin olive oil
  • 4 units garlic cloves
  • 4 units anchovy fillets
  • 300 grams cherry tomatoes
  • 100 grams black olives (pitted)
  • 2 tablespoons capers (rinsed)
  • 1 teaspoon red chili flakes
  • 2 tablespoons parsley (chopped)
  • 50 grams grated Parmesan cheese
  • 1 teaspoon salt
  • 1 teaspoon black pepper

📝 Instructions

10 steps
1

Bring a large pot of salted water to boil. Add the spaghetti and cook according to the package instructions until al dente. Reserve 1 cup of pasta water, then drain the rest and set the spaghetti aside.

2

While the pasta is cooking, heat the olive oil in a large skillet over medium heat.

3

Finely chop the garlic cloves and sauté them in the olive oil for about 1-2 minutes, or until fragrant.

4

Add the anchovy fillets to the skillet. Use a wooden spoon to break them down into the oil as they cook for 2 minutes.

5

Halve the cherry tomatoes and add them to the skillet. Cook for 5-7 minutes until they soften, stirring occasionally.

6

Stir in the black olives, rinsed capers, and red chili flakes. Cook for another 2 minutes to combine the flavors.

7

Add the cooked spaghetti to the skillet along with a splash of the reserved pasta water. Toss everything together until the sauce evenly coats the pasta. Add more pasta water as needed to adjust the consistency.

8

Season with salt and black pepper to taste, keeping in mind that the anchovies, olives, and capers add some saltiness.

9

Remove the skillet from heat and stir in the chopped parsley.

10

Serve hot, topped with grated Parmesan cheese.
